1️⃣ Introduction

The modern battlefield increasingly relies on radar networks integrated with AI, but this introduces a cyber dimension.

Ep 7 explores how cyber threats, AI algorithms, and countermeasures interact with next-gen radar systems, impacting decision-making and air defense.


2️⃣ Key Themes

AI Vulnerabilities

Machine learning algorithms can be manipulated by adversarial inputs, leading to false positives or missed detections.

Cyber Attacks on Radar Networks

Malware, jamming, or spoofing can disrupt the communication and data fusion across multi-domain systems.

Countermeasures

Redundant networks, encryption, and AI anomaly detection help protect radar assets.

Cyber-hardened AI enables systems to detect and isolate attacks in real time.

Operational Impact

Faster detection of cyber threats protects IADS effectiveness.

AI-assisted defenses reduce human workload and allow for proactive threat mitigation.


3️⃣ Strategic Implications

Nations investing in AI + cyber-hardened radar gain both technological and strategic superiority.

Multi-domain integration becomes riskier if cyber vulnerabilities are ignored, highlighting the need for continuous monitoring and adaptation.

Future air defense will rely as much on cybersecurity as on traditional radar coverage.


4️⃣ Conclusion

AI + radar networks are force multipliers, but cyber risks must be actively managed.

Integrating cyber-hardened AI with multi-domain radar systems is essential for next-gen battlefield readiness
